Annual Eye Check-Up
Page 10
The annual eye check-up were conducted for Kindergarten 1 and Kindergarten 2 children. The children were also taught about good eye care habits. This event had helped to promote children’s understanding in taking care of their eyes. Children can now reflect on their prior experiences and able to identify the bad habits which can affect their eyesight. Good eye care habits: Read under good light Read a book 30cm away Rest eyes after 30 minutes of work by looking at
greeneries or away Sit 2.5 meters from the TV

Prior to KMBR’s Chinese New Year Celebration, the centre had a cultural week from the 18th January to 25th January to create awareness of the upcoming celebration and to introduce children to the Chinese culture and customs. Children joined the fun of the music and movements such as the fan dance, ribbon dance and lion dance and singing to Chinese songs such as Gongxi Gongxi and Xin Nian Hao. Children understood better about items associated with Chinese culture such as fan, dragon, lantern and rooster. Children did various crafts as they learnt about the different objects. They also learnt the Chinese culture and customs through storytelling which explained about how Chinese New Year is celebrated, what red symbolises and knowing more about Chinese goodies such as pineapple tarts.

Term 1 : Care for Friends Day This is our first ever Disposition Day for the children. For term 1, ‘Care for Our Friends’ Day was celebrated on 6th March 2017. On this special day, the children learnt some ways on how to show appreciation towards their friends. Children were engaged in singing and dancing to songs about friends. They enjoyed listening to the storytelling of the storybook “The Rainbow Fish”, which teaches children about sharing is caring. They had fun cooking together the Marshmallow Popcorn Balls. The children did a variety of crafts for their peers to show their appreciation towards them. Some of these crafts were friendship bands, friendship bracelets, cards, friendship trees and flowers. Lastly, the children exchanged gifts with one another to express their gratitude and to be thankful for one another.
